Sanctification in the Lord, by the Spirit, at the Heart of Marriage (Family Worship lesson in 1Thessalonians 4:1–8)
What is God’s will for me? What is God’s will for my marriage? Pastor leads his family in today’s “Hopewell @Home” passage. 1Thessalonians 4:1–8 prepares us for the first serial reading in morning public worship on the coming Lord’s Day. In these eight verses of Holy Scripture, the Holy Spirit teaches us that God’s will for every part of a believer’s life is sanctification. This means that just as important as the question of whom to marry is the question of how to approach marriage. In this, sanctification is to be prioritized, passions of the heart and flesh resisted, parents consulted, Christ to be pleased, and the Holy Spirit to be depended upon.(click here to DOWNLOAD mp3/pdf files of this lesson)

Recognizing, Avoiding, & Not-Being the Foolish Woman of Death (Family Worship in Proverbs 9:13–18)
Lady Folly is dangerous! Step through her door, and plummet to Hell! So it is important to note her features and avoid her (or avoid being her): noisy/showy, always out and about instead of at home, rebelliously implying that rules are there to keep you from enjoyment, offering the feeling of being special without the corresponding commitment.
